Requirements
  • A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, or a related technical discipline is required.
  • At least 10 years of professional experience developing and supporting PTC Windchill Product Lifecycle Management solutions is required.
  • Expert-level experience with the Windchill Java API, Info*Engine, workflows, lifecycle templates, Object Initialization Rules, and access control configuration is required.
  • Strong knowledge of Java, JSP, HTML, JavaScript, SQL, and the Windchill data model is required.
  • Extensive experience designing and implementing Windchill customizations, integrations, and enterprise extensions is required.
  • Proven experience supporting Windchill upgrades, migrations, performance tuning, and production support is required.
  • Experience integrating Windchill with enterprise applications using REST APIs, SOAP web services, JMS, or middleware technologies is required.
  • Strong understanding of Product Lifecycle Management, Engineering Change Management, CAD data management, and product configuration processes is required.
  • Experience with troubleshooting, documentation, stakeholder management, and technical leadership is required.
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, and implement advanced PTC Windchill customizations using the Windchill Java API and industry best practices.
  • Architect and configure workflows, lifecycle templates, Object Initialization Rules, access control policies, and Info*Engine tasks.
  • Develop custom services, event listeners, web services, REST APIs, and enterprise integrations with ERP, MES, CRM, and other enterprise systems.
  • Customize Windchill user interfaces using JSP, HTML, JavaScript, and related web technologies.
  • Design and implement data migration strategies, bulk data loading processes, and system upgrade plans.
  • Optimize Windchill performance, troubleshoot production issues, and ensure high availability and system reliability.
  • Develop reports, dashboards, and data extraction solutions to support business and engineering requirements.
  • Collaborate with engineering, manufacturing, product management, and business stakeholders to deliver scalable Product Lifecycle Management solutions.
  • Lead technical design reviews, establish development standards, and ensure adherence to PTC best practices.
  • Mentor junior developers, provide technical leadership, maintain solution documentation, and support enterprise-wide Windchill initiatives.

Bright Vision Technologies offers Lumina, an AI-powered platform for talent intelligence and enterprise automation, along with consulting and staffing services. Lumina analyzes unstructured data with generative AI, Large Language Models orchestrated via LangChain, and Retrieval-Augmented Generation to support sourcing and screening candidates, integrated with CRM, ERP, and HRMS on a cloud-native microservices architecture across A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ud. The company differentiates itself by combining a sophisticated AI product with hands-on consulting and staffing expertise, plus its minority-owned status and a dual model that helps clients implement technology and solve broader business challenges. Its goal is to streamline and automate complex workflows in IT talent acquisition and management to enable digital transformation and efficient enterprise operations.
